A fairly good sized antique market in a very pleasant setting (Ellicott City). Spent a couple of hours wandering around. More vintage than antique, but saw a few good pieces. Only downside is that none of the booth owners are on site (just a central cashier) so the haggling which is typical doesn't exist.
